Eli Lilly (LLY): Why This Pharmaceutical Giant Remains a Top Investment Choice

Baron Funds’ latest investor letter for the second quarter of 2025 provides a crucial look into the challenging landscape facing the broader healthcare sector. The period saw the Baron Health Care Fund decline by 5.06% for Institutional Shares, a performance set against a backdrop where the Russell 3000 Health Care Index also experienced a 6.19% decline, contrasting sharply with a 10.99% gain for the broader Russell 3000 Index. This divergence highlights the specific pressures and dynamics at play within the healthcare investment arena during this recent quarter.

Despite these overall market conditions, the Baron Health Care Fund highlighted several prominent healthcare stocks, with particular attention given to Eli Lilly and Company (LLY). Delving into the specifics of Eli Lilly (LLY), the company’s stock performance recorded a one-month return of -2.64%, and its shares saw a 5.52% loss over the last 52 weeks. As of July 30, 2025, Eli Lilly (LLY) stock closed at a price of $760.08 per share, underscoring its significant valuation within the market. With a formidable market capitalization reaching $682.351 billion, Eli Lilly (LLY) stands as a titan in the global pharmaceutical landscape. Baron Funds elaborated on its position regarding Eli Lilly (LLY) in their second-quarter letter, placing the company in the 21st position on their exclusive list of top holdings. This ranking signifies its importance within their portfolio, reflecting a sustained conviction in its long-term potential despite short-term fluctuations. Further demonstrating investor confidence and market presence, the number of hedge fund portfolios holding Eli Lilly (LLY) increased to 119 at the end of the first quarter, up from 115 in the preceding quarter. This growing institutional interest underscores a broad recognition of the company’s value proposition within the pharmaceutical industry, indicating strong belief in its foundational strengths.

Notably, Eli Lilly (LLY) reported exceptionally strong financial results in the first quarter of 2025, with revenue surging an impressive 45% compared to the first quarter of 2024. This significant growth highlights the company’s operational strength and its ability to generate substantial earnings, contributing to its status as a potentially lucrative healthcare investment opportunity for many.

While acknowledging the inherent risks and considerable potential of Eli Lilly (LLY) as an investment, Baron Funds also revealed a strategic shift in their conviction. Their latest assessment suggests that certain AI stocks may offer even greater promise for delivering higher returns within a shorter timeframe, presenting an evolving perspective on lucrative opportunities in the dynamic investment landscape.
